MTV TAKES THE SUMMER CONCERT SCENE BY MOBILE TRUCK ON THE "VMA POP-UP TOUR" PRESENTED BY VERIZON IN CELEBRATION OF THE 2013 "MTV VIDEO MUSIC AWARDS"

MTV VMA "Artist To Watch" Nominee Austin Mahone to Perform in Coney Island

New York, NY (August 22, 2013) - MTV announced today the "VMA Pop-Up Tour" presented by Verizon will roll through various music festivals and concerts throughout New York leading up to and in celebration of the 2013 "MTV Video Music Awards." Traveling across the city via custom mobile truck, tour stops will provide fans and concert-goers with a fun and festive block party experience complete with VMA inspired music, trivia, games, premium prizes and more. Additionally, in the spirit of summer, popsicles will be handed out to fans. One lucky person at each stop with the winning stick will receive tickets to the 2013 "MTV Video Music Awards," which airs live on Sunday, August 25 at 9:00 p.m. ET/PT.

The "VMA Pop-Up Tour" presented by Verizon kicked off on Saturday, August 10 at Williamsburg Park in Brooklyn, NY at the Mad Decent Block Party. Mixing and mingling with the crowd, DJ Yoshi spun music from VMA nominated artists and attendees had the opportunity to take photos with this year's specially re-designed Moonman, re-imagined by world-renowned, Brooklyn-based artist KAWS.

Additional upcoming stops along the "VMA Pop Up-Tour" include the Jake Miller concert at Rye Playland on Friday, August 23 from 4:00 - 7:00 p.m. and the Austin Mahone concert at Coney Island in Brooklyn on Saturday, August 24, doors open at 2:00 p.m. Throughout the rest of this week fans are invited to follow the hashtag #VMAPopUp for more information about the "VMA Pop-Up Tour" including the truck, its whereabouts and opportunities to get tickets to the Austin Mahone concert on Saturday.
